| HistoryText = '''John Diggle''' is a former soldier of the U.S. Military and the first vigilante partner of [[Oliver Queen (Prime Earth)|Green Arrow]]. Before starting his vigilante career with Green Arrow, John was working as part of security for [[Queen Industries]].
 
===Zero Year===
 
During the [[Batman: Zero Year|Zero Year]], Diggle was on the job in [[Gotham City]], protecting [[Moira Queen]], who was being targeted by [[Drury Walker (Prime Earth)|Killer Moth]].<ref name=G25>{{C|Green Arrow Vol 5 25}}</ref>
 
 
===Helping Green Arrow===
 
While sitting in his apartment one night, Diggle was paid a visit by the Green Arrow, who was bleeding out and needed help. Diggle patched him up, and was asked by Oliver to join him in his crusade to protect the city. Oliver trusted Diggle due to him not revealing his identity to anyone, telling anyone he was back, and the fact that Diggle was willing to protect Oliver's mother's life with his own. Diggle joined Oliver's crusade and the two operated as a team to protect the city.<ref name=G25/>
 
 
===Outsiders War===
 
During [[Jeff Lemire]]'s run, Diggle returned to Seattle to seek the help of crime boss [[William Tockman (Prime Earth)|William Tockman]] to take down [[Ricardo Diaz, Jr. (Prime Earth)|Ricardo Diaz, Jr.]], A.K.A. Richard Dragon. He also recruited the help of [[Naomi Singh (Prime Earth)|Naomi Singh]] and [[Henry Fyff (Prime Earth)|Henry Fyff]]. Tockman eventually turned on Diggle, stating that Dragon offered him a better deal. The villains let Fyff and Singh go, but kept Diggle as leverage against the Green Arrow.
 
 
===Broken===
 
While captured by Richard Dragon, Diggle is beaten and learns Dragon's origin story. Diggle then tells Dragon that it wasn't Oliver as the Green Arrow that killed his father, putting him on his current path, but actually Diggle, who had taken the suit without Oliver's permission. This is revealed to be the reason Diggle left Team Arrow the first time around.
 
When Oliver returns to Seattle, he is informed of the situation and rushes to help Diggle. Oliver arrives to find Diggle falling to his death. After saving Diggle from his fall, the pair head back to where Richard Dragon is. Neither is able to defeat him on their own, but together they put a stop to Dragon's takeover of Seattle.
 
 
===Future's End===
 
In the [[Futures End]] event, taking place in a possible future, Diggle is seen as one of the pallbearers at Oliver's funeral. When Oliver reveals he is not actually dead, Diggle is seen helping Oliver with his assault on CADMUS Island.
 
 
===Kingdom===
 
While Oliver's team heals from the attack by Richard Dragon, Diggle stays in Seattle, helping Oliver in the field and occasionally over radio communications.
 
 
===Rebirth===
 
During the events of [[DC Rebirth]], Diggle was working as a soldier for hire. He returned to Seattle after recieving an anonymous message about Oliver Queen's death. After he learns that Queen is not dead, they exchange blows while Diggle blames Oliver for the death of the woman he loved a year prior. Ultimately, he joined forces with Oliver and the rest of Team Arrow once again to take down the [[Ninth Circle (Prime Earth)|Ninth Circle]].
 
 
When Oliver was about to kill [[Malcolm Merlyn (Prime Earth)|Malcom Merlyn]], Diggle knocks him out and saves the dark archer, stating that Merlyn saved his life in the past. Later Diggle is shown tending to Merlyn's wounds. Merlyn tells Diggle that he can't play on both sides, and will have to eventually choose between himself and Oliver Queen.
